2009-06-24 8 views
0

방금 ​​훨씬 효율적으로 구현할 수있는 간단한 Unix 명령 행 유틸리티를 작성했습니다. 필자는 여러 입력에 대해 실행하고 소요 시간을 측정하여 성능을 측정 할 수 있습니다. 그러면 숫자 s 쌍의 세트가 생성됩니다. 여기서 s는 입력 크기이고 t는 처리 시간입니다. 내 유틸리티의 성능 특성을 결정하려면이 데이터 포인트를 통해 함수를 맞추어야합니다. 이 작업은 수동으로 수행 할 수 있지만 게으르다가 유틸리티를 사용하여 작업하도록하는 것이 더 좋습니다.커맨드 라인에서 2D 비 다항식 피팅

그런 유틸리티가 있습니까?

입력은 숫자 쌍의 순서입니다. 출력은 두 번째 숫자가 첫 번째 함수의 함수와 오류 측정 값에 따라 달라지는 방식을 나타내는 수식입니다.

한 가지 방법은 다항식의 경우에만이를 수행하는 유틸리티를 사용하는 것입니다. 이 has been discussed here하지만 바로 사용할 수있는 솔루션이 아닙니다.

다음 단계는 다항식 항을 시도하도록 유틸리티를 확장하는 것입니다. 음의 차수 다항식 (y = 1/x와 같이)과 로그 항 (y = x log x와 같이)을 시도해야합니다. 잘. 비 다항식 항에 대처하는 한 가지 아이디어는 x와 y 축 변환으로 다항식 피팅을 둘러싸는 것입니다. 그게 할 수 있을지 나는 모른다. This question은 관련되어 있지만 정확히 일치하지는 않습니다.

내가 말했듯이, 나는 게으르다 : 나는 이것을 어떻게 쓰는가에 대한 아이디어를 찾고 있지 않다. 나는 이미 나를 위해 해낸 프로젝트의 신뢰할 수있는 결과를 찾고있다. 어떤 제안?

답변

1

나는 SAS가 이것을 가지고 있다고 믿고있다. RS/1은 이것을 가지고있다. Mathematica는 이것을 가지고 있으며, Execel과 대부분의 스프레드 시트는 이것의 기본 형태를 가지고 있다고 생각하며, 더 많은 고급 형식을위한 추가 기능이있다. 이런 종류의 실험실 분석 및 통계 분석 도구가 많이 있습니다. .

RE, 명령 행 도구 :

SAS, RS/1 Minitab에서 20 년 전 내가 그들을 사용할 때 모든 명령 줄 도구였다. 나는 그들 중 적어도 하나가 여전히이 능력을 가지고 있다고 확신한다.

+0

나는 명령 행 도구를 찾고있다. – reinierpost

관련 문제